Oakwood is the most distinctive bath market in the Dayton area because of its pre-1940 housing stock. Original Oakwood baths are typically small (one or two per home in the older Tudor and Colonial Revival homes), with period tile (subway, hex, geometric mosaic), original cast-iron tubs (often claw-foot), pedestal sinks, and tile or marble wainscoting. About 80% of our Oakwood clients want period-appropriate restorations — preserving the architectural character while modernizing waterproofing, plumbing, and fixtures.
We source period-correct subway tile, hex floor, claw-foot tubs (or substantial Victorian-style alcove tubs), nickel and chrome cross-handle fixtures. Master suite additions are common in Oakwood — many of the original homes had only one or two baths total, so creating a primary suite from existing bedroom or attic space is a frequent project type.
The Schantz Park Historic District requires Historic Preservation Board review for any exterior-visible work; interior work flows through Oakwood's standard building permit process. We've worked extensively in the Far Hills corridor, Schantz Park, the Forrer-Triangle-Shafor avenues area, and the streets around Smith Memorial Gardens.

Oakwood is a preservation-minded community and bathroom remodels here need a different mindset than newer builds. We coordinate with city zoning when needed, source period-appropriate tile (subway in 3×6, hex floor mosaic, marble basketweave), and rebuild claw-foot tubs in place when homeowners want to keep them. Plumbing in pre-war homes often needs full rough-in replacement — we plan for it from day one.

Oakwood is one of Ohio’s best-preserved early-20th-century communities, and its bathrooms are a specialty of ours. The housing is strong pre-1940 stock — Tudors, Colonial Revivals, and Cape Cods — around the Schantz Park Historic District and the boulevards along Far Hills, Triangle, Shafor, and Forrer avenues. These baths are often small, tiled floor to ceiling, and untouched for decades.
Behind Oakwood’s plaster walls you often find original wiring and framing that predate modern standards. Our up-front assessment catches all of it before the quote, so a period bath gets modern, waterproof function without losing its character.
